Chap. 167.—An ACT to amend the Tax Code of Virginia by adding thereto a new
section, to be numbered section 402-a, making it a misdemeanor and malfeas-
ance in office for a county or city treasurer knowingly to omit from any delin-
quent list required by the Tax Code of Virginia to be prepared by him, any
taxes or levies which are in fact delinquent, and which should be included in
such delinquent list. [H B 268]
Approved March 22, 1932
1. Be it enacted by the general assembly of Virginia, That the
Tax Code of Virginia be amended by adding thereto a new section,
to be numbered section four hundred and two-a, which new section
shall read as follows:
Section 402-a. If any county or city treasurer shall knowingly
omit from any delinquent list required by the Tax Code of Virginia
to be prepared by him, any taxes or levies which are in fact delin-
quent and which should be included in such delinquent list, such
county or city treasurer shall be guilty of a misdemeanor, and upon
conviction thereof, shall be fined not less than one hundred dollars
nor more than five hundred dollars for each offense; and such county
or city treasurer shall moreover be deemed guilty of malfeasance in
